Eurostar London to Paris Tips for First-Time Travelers
Book your Eurostar tickets from London to Paris with these essential tips for first-time travelers, ensuring a memorable journey awaits you.
Book your Eurostar tickets from London to Paris with these essential tips for first-time travelers, ensuring a memorable journey awaits you.